'13 BRZ Auto - Jerky when turning from a dead stop
Just something I've noticed a lot since I got this car about 5 months ago.
I asked the dealer about it and they acted like they had no idea what I was talking about. If I'm totally stopped and turning right or left, as soon as I hit the gas it kinda jerks like the rear wheels are posi or something, fighting to go at different speeds or slipping a little on the pavement. It's consistent. Normal driving mode. The more I gun it the worse it is. I've adjusted my driving to try and minimize it by trying to start out more strait or just slower on the pedal. I'm just wondering if this is inherent with the RWD design or if it might actually be problem. -Scott |
